‘Let’s grow together’ is CooperVision’s overall theme for the British Contact Lens Association’s (BCLA) clinical conference and exhibition in Liverpool this week (29–31 May).

Focusing on partnership and vision, the contact lens manufacturer, a partner sponsor of the event, will share its perspective on helping practitioners grow their practice.

Delegates are invited to visit stand 24 to experience CooperVision’s ‘quintessential country garden,’ complete with croquet lawn and botanical bar. The stand will provide the setting for a number of interactive events and activities, as well as business track sessions offering key insights into how practitioners can grow their practice.

The conference will be underpinned by two key presentations; the partner presentation and the partner showcase.

The partner presentation, taking place on Friday (29 May) at 5.30pm, will be led by CooperVision’s European professional services director, Sue Cockayne (pictured).

Ms Cockayne will chart the evolution of daily disposable contact lenses, whilst also looking at how today’s products are addressing the needs of wearers, with comfort, convenience and health at the top of the agenda. The presentation will include a review of CooperVision’s MyDay contact lenses, as well as the world’s first and only full range of silicone hydrogel daily disposable contact lenses, clariti 1 day.

CooperVision’s Marathon of comfort partner showcase presentation will take place on Sunday (31 May) at 11am. CooperVision’s professional services training manager, Elizabeth Lumb, will focus on frequent replacement contact lenses and seek to equip practitioners with the tools to provide contact lens wearers with the best possible comfort experience.

On Saturday (30 May), CooperVision’s European head of customer marketing, Jason Burkinshaw, will be drawing on his 15 years of experience at Coca-Cola as part of the business track. He will expand on CooperVision’s recently commissioned YouGov survey results to provide valuable insights into customer loyalty and the impact of this on practitioners and their business growth.

Daily disposable contact lens fitting will be held on the stand, showcasing CooperVision’s newly expanded portfolio. There will also be the big reveal of the winning entry in the recent Life Enhancing Contact Lenses competition and a celebratory Champagne reception on the stand on Friday from 6pm.
